A German meteorologist and polar researcher who proposed continental drift, the idea that today's continents were once a single landmass that broke apart and drifted to their present positions. Dismissed by most geologists in his own time for want of a mechanism, he died on a Greenland expedition in 1930, three decades before seafloor spreading vindicated the core of his idea.

Defining Contribution
A meteorologist by training, proposed in 1912 that the continents had once been joined in a single landmass and were slowly drifting apart. The idea was rejected in his lifetime for lacking a mechanism, and became the accepted foundation of plate tectonics only after seafloor spreading supplied one in the 1960s. 1

Why this is disputed. Wegener is credited with developing continental drift into a comprehensive, evidence-based theory published in 1912, but the core idea that continents had once fit together or moved was proposed by others earlier, including Antonio Snider-Pellegrini in 1858 and Frank Bursley Taylor, whose continental-creep model was presented in 1908 and published in 1910.

Concepts Credited: Continental Drift

Antonio Snider-Pellegrini illustrated in 1858 how the Atlantic coastlines could be closed together into a single landmass, and Frank Bursley Taylor proposed a mechanism of continental creep in 1908 (published 1910), the first to link continental motion to mountain building, attributing the Himalaya to the Indian subcontinent's collision with Asia. Wegener's distinct and larger contribution, the reason the theory carries his name, was assembling geological, paleontological and paleoclimatic evidence into a single systematic, testable case in 1912.
